Pudina Rice Recipe | Mint Rice | an easy and flavored rice-based recipe made with mint leaves. Traditional pulao is made with a combination of mint and coriander leaves, but I like this recipe with more pudhina leaves in it.
An ideal lunch box or tiffin box recipe which can be served as it is or with yogurt-based raita. Mint pulao is highly recommended during indigestion as it is a good source of antioxidants. Secondly, it is also served for a common cold or running nose problem. I grind a paste for this recipe. I hope you will like this recipe.
